The Importance of Financial Reserves for Companies

Companies, regardless of their size or sector, face market variations that can directly impact their revenues and expenses.

In unpredictable economic scenarios, such as global financial crises, pandemics or fluctuations in demand.

Organizations that have a solid financial reserve are able to stay afloat, while those that do not prepare run serious risks of bankruptcy.

Furthermore, the financial reserve for companies offers a layer of protection against operational unforeseen events.

Unexpected expenses may arise, such as the breakdown of essential equipment.

Thus, the need to renovate a physical space or even hire new employees to meet a sudden demand.

Without this reserve, these expenses can become a burden, compromising cash flow and even resulting in unnecessary debt.

Furthermore, another point to consider is the investment opportunity.

Companies often come across good opportunities for expansion, whether through the acquisition of competitors, new equipment or the exploration of new markets.

Having a well-structured financial reserve allows these opportunities to be taken advantage of without the need for last-minute loans, which often have high costs.

Impact of Reservation on Business Management

A company's financial health is directly linked to its efficient management capacity.

When there is a financial reserve, managers have more peace of mind when making strategic decisions, as they know that the organization has a “cushion” to absorb external shocks.

This creates a safer environment for innovation and growth, as well as providing greater scope for negotiating contracts and payments with suppliers.

In times of crisis, such as the COVID-19 pandemic, many companies that had financial reserves were able to keep their operations up to date.

As well as paying salaries and suppliers, and even adapting quickly to new market conditions.

This decisive factor shows that the lack of a reserve can not only stagnate a company's growth, but also compromise its survival.

Therefore, it is essential to highlight that having a financial reserve allows companies to act more strategically, rather than reactively.

Without a reserve, organizations are at the mercy of external circumstances, often having to make hasty and disadvantageous decisions for the business.

How to Build a Financial Reserve for Companies

Creating a solid financial reserve is a task that requires planning, discipline and commitment.

The first step is to determine the ideal value of this reserve, which varies according to the size of the company, sector of activity and risks involved.

It is generally recommended that the reserve cover three to six months of the company's fixed operating costs, but this amount can be adjusted as needed.

A good strategy for forming this reserve is to allocate a fixed percentage of the company's monthly revenue to a specific fund.

Instead of expecting leftovers at the end of the month, it is more efficient to view this reserve as a mandatory expense, such as paying suppliers or paying employees' salaries.

This approach prevents the fund from being neglected during periods of higher revenue.

To make things easier, you can create a planning table, like the one shown below, which will help you determine how much you need to set aside and track your progress over time:

MonthInvoicingFixed ExpensesPercentage allocated to the ReserveAccumulated Reserve Value
JanuaryR$ 100,000R$ 60,0005%R$ 5,000
FebruaryR$ 110,000R$ 60,0005%R$ 10.500
MarchR$ 120,000R$ 65,0005%R$ 16.000
AprilR$ 130,000R$ 70,0005%R$ 22.500

Over time, the reserved amount increases continuously and predictably, without affecting cash flow. Of course, this percentage can be adjusted according to the company's financial situation.

However, it is essential that the reserve is treated as a priority in financial planning.

Where to Store the Reserve?

Another crucial point is to define where the reserve money will be kept.

Keeping this amount in a checking account may not be the best option, as it will lose value over time due to inflation.

Therefore, it is interesting to consider low-risk and highly liquid investments, such as government bonds, short-term CDBs or conservative investment funds.

Investing your savings wisely ensures that the value is not only preserved, but can also yield some return while it is not being used.

However, it is important that the investments chosen allow quick access to the money, since the purpose of the reserve is to be available for emergencies.

Practical Tips for Managing Your Financial Reserve

The management of the financial reserve must be continuous and adaptive, ensuring that it fulfills its role without affecting other areas of the company.

Below, we list some good practices that can help in this process:

1. Periodic Review of Reserve Value

The amount needed for the reserve may vary as the company grows or faces new challenges.

Therefore, it is important to carry out periodic reviews of the amount reserved.

As revenue and costs increase, the reserve must also be adjusted to keep up with these changes.

Carrying out a half-yearly or annual review ensures that the reserve is always in line with the company's reality.

Furthermore, this practice helps to identify whether the fund is being underutilized or whether there is a need for greater investments in new assets.

2. Clear Separation of Funds

It is essential to keep the financial reserve separate from the company's working capital.

Commingling these funds can lead to confusion and misuse of reserved resources.

The best way to avoid this is to create a specific account for the reserve and ensure that it is only used in emergency situations or for strategic opportunities.

Separating funds allows for a clear and precise view of the company's real financial health, which makes it easier to control finances and make decisions.

3. Awareness of Usage Scenarios

Having a financial reserve is an advantage, but you need to know when to use it.

Daily expenses should not be covered by the reserve.

It should be intended for emergencies, such as periods of sharp decline in revenue or unexpected expenses that could not be foreseen.

Furthermore, it can be used to take advantage of opportunities that bring clear and immediate returns to the company.

Financial reserve for companies: How to Use the Reserve Strategically

Having a financial reserve doesn’t just mean saving it and never using it. For it to be truly useful, it’s important to know how and when to use it.

There are different ways to apply the reserve, from crisis management to taking advantage of strategic opportunities.

1. Facing Crises with the Reserve

In times of crisis, such as sudden drops in revenue, the reserve can be used to cover fixed operating costs, such as rent, salaries and suppliers.

This way, the company gains time to adjust its strategy without having to resort to high-interest loans or drastically cut essential costs.

Using the reserve during crises allows the company to maintain the trust of customers, employees and suppliers, demonstrating solidity and commitment to its operations.

2. Seizing Expansion Opportunities

Companies with a robust financial reserve have a competitive advantage when expansion opportunities arise.

Whether it’s through purchasing new equipment, expanding your team or entering new markets, the reserve can be used as a boost for growth.

However, it is essential to carry out a careful analysis before using these funds.

Expansion must be planned and strategic, with clear and tangible return projections for the company.

3. Balance between Emergencies and Opportunities

While it may be tempting to use your reserve for every new opportunity, it is important to maintain a balance.

Emergencies are unpredictable and therefore the reserve should not be completely depleted in a single expansion action.

Keeping part of the fund available for eventualities guarantees the company's security.

THE financial reserve for companies It is, without a doubt, one of the main instruments of security and growth in the corporate environment.

By managing it intelligently, companies not only protect themselves against crises, but also position themselves to take advantage of new market opportunities.

Therefore, creating a solid reserve, accompanied by disciplined financial management, is an essential step towards the longevity and sustainable success of any organization.
